2 held for stealing cash, jewels from employer’s house

banner img
Ludhiana: Three persons who had been working as domestic help in house for almost a decade stole cash and jewellery worth lakhs. One of them was caught red-handed stealing at the house of their employer in Ayali Kalan on Friday. Police arrested the two accused, Rajesh Kumar and Rahul Kumar while their accomplice, Shiva is at large. All the three belong to Uttar Pradesh.
The complainant, Vishvas Puri, a resident of SBS Nagar said that he works in a private firm owned by Amrinder Singh of Garden Enclave, Ayali Kalan. For the past few months, he said his employer Amrinder was upset as cash and jewellery was being stolen from his house. He said he discussed the issue with him.
On Thursday, Puri said he went to Amrinder’s house, where he saw his (Amrinder’s) domestic help Rajesh stealing cash from the bedroom. He said he raised an alarm and nabbed him. Rajesh confessed and said that the other two persons working in the house, Rahul and Shiva were also involved in the theft. At this, they caught Rahul and called the police.
The investigating officer, ASI Jaspal Singh from Raghunath police post said that the accused have been working in the house for almost a decade now and the employer did not suspect their involvement when cash and valuables started going missing. The accused said they used to send the stolen gold and diamond jewellery to their family back home. He said they would try to recover the stolen articles and arrest the accused.
Sarabha Nagar police lodged an FIR under sections 381 (theft by clerk or servant) and 34 (Act done by several persons in furtherance of common intention) of the IPC.
